Chelsea boss Graham Potter has been urged to play Enzo Fernandez in a more advanced position for Chelsea.

Former Chelsea boss Glenn Hoddle was impressed with the performance of Fernandez in Chelsea’s goalless draw against Fulham on Friday night.

Despite only arriving London on Wednesday, Fernandez started the game against Fulham on Friday night.

Elegant on the ball and tough in the tackle, the Argentina World Cup star impressed at the base of Chelsea’s midfield but Hoddle feels the 22-year-old would fare even better in a more attacking role.

Hoddle told Premier League Productions: “I thought Fernandez played well he looks as though he’s going to get better and better and will probably play in a more advanced position rather than just a holder.”
